  • Effect of Wet-grinding of Mix on Quality of Iron Ore ...

    The effects of wet-grinding on the quality of wet pellet, preheated pellet and fired pellets were studied in this paper. The results show that the amount of bentonite is lowered,the strength of wet pellet, preheated pellet and fired pellets are improved, but the shock temperature of wet pellets is slightly lowered through the pretreatment of wet-grinding of mix.

  • Grinding Iron Ore in a Wet Autogenous Mill - 911

    2020-1-9  The Cretaceous plant at the Hill Annex mine of the Jones Laughlin Steel Corp. was designed with a wet autogenous mill for grinding low grade iron ore so that it could be concentrated by spirals and flotation cells.   • Wet grindability of an industrial ore and its breakage ...

    2011-1-17  Wet grinding was employed to avoid dust loss. The grinding time, determined by pre-tests, was chosen to make an amount between 20% and 80% of the material break out of the top-size intervals. At the end of each grinding period, the mill was immediately emptied into a grid screen by washing the mill and the balls.

  • Characterization and Comminution Studies of Low

    2019-1-31  Banded hematite quartzite (BHQ) and banded hematite jasper (BHJ) ores represent a promising potential iron ore resource in the near future. The hematite and quartz in BHQ and the hematite and jasper in BHJ are closely related and require fine grinding for the liberation of hematite phases. The present study investigates the mineralogical features and comminution properties of BHQ and BHJ ores.

  • Iron Ore Processing,Crushing,Grinding Plant Machine

    Iron ore is the key raw material for steel production enterprises. Generally, iron ore with a grade of less than 50% needs to be processed before smelting and utilization. After crushing, grinding, magnetic separation, flotation, and gravity separation, etc., iron is gradually selected from the natural iron ore.

  • PROCESS FOR BENEFICIATING MAGNETITE IRON ORE

    Title: PROCESS FOR BENEFICIATING MAGNETITE IRON ORE. United States Patent 3672579. Abstract: A process for upgrading low-grade magnetite-containing iron ore with minimum fine grinding. The dry ore is first comminuted to between about three-fourths inch and 10 mesh particle size and magnetically separated.
